MAPPA Confirms ‘Jimoto Saiko!’ Anime for Netflix as Part of 15th Anniversary Lineup

MAPPA has officially revealed a new anime adaptation of Jimoto Saikō! (Hometown is the Best!), confirming that the series will stream globally on Netflix. The announcement came during the studio’s 15th Anniversary Lineup Reveal ">livestream via MAPPA’s YouTube Channel on June 19, signaling another major addition to its growing international catalog.

The project is based on the manga by Usagi and will bring a darker, more grounded narrative compared to many mainstream anime titles.

A Gritty Story Set in a Harsh Hometown

Unlike traditional school or slice-of-life anime, Jimoto Saiko! centers on a group of girls steering life in a troubled environment. The story follows Chanel and her friend Chihiro as they grow up in a hometown marked by violence, drugs, poverty, and discrimination.

The narrative presents a stark portrayal of youth caught in difficult circumstances, with older students depicted as heavily tattooed, aggressive, and immersed in risky behavior. This setting establishes a tone that is far more intense than typical coming-of-age anime.

By focusing on survival and resilience, the series is expected to explore themes of identity, friendship, and the struggle to overcome one’s surroundings.

The original manga gained attention after being launched on X (formerly Twitter), where it steadily built a following. Its raw storytelling and unfiltered depiction of urban life helped it stand out in a crowded manga terrain.

Published by Saizusha, the series released its first compiled volume in 2022 and has since expanded to multiple volumes, reflecting growing reader interest. The upcoming anime adaptation marks a significant step forward, bringing the story to a much wider global audience.

Creative Team Behind the Adaptation

The anime will be directed by Tokio Igarashi, with scripts handled by Ryō Takata. Character design is led by Rio, while Naoki Takada serves as art director.

Additional staff includes Yukiko Kakita as color designer, Yōsei Sawai overseeing 3DCG, and Kaori Yoneda as director of photography. Editing will be handled by Tomoki Nagasaka, with Takahiro Ogawa serving as animation producer.

MAPPA Expands Its Global Streaming Strategy

The decision to release Jimoto Saiko! on Netflix reflects MAPPA’s continued push toward international audiences. Streaming platforms have become a key avenue for anime distribution, allowing studios to reach viewers far beyond Japan.

By choosing Netflix, MAPPA ensures that the series will have immediate global accessibility, which is particularly important for a story that tackles universal social issues.
